Editors’ Review
Anime Maker - Creator Your Personal Avatar Face, developed by tokulen, helps Android users craft anime-style digital identities with a visual editor and manual controls. The app focuses on avatar creation for profile images and creative projects, blending layered styling with finishing adjustments. It supplies asset-based customization for appearance and scene composition. Anime fans, social media profile seekers, and casual character designers find practical, fast tools for producing distinct avatar images.

Anime Maker uses a hybrid creation method that accepts a device photo as a starting point and then applies manual edits, so outputs can range from realistic likenesses to fantasy characters. The editor exposes facial adjustments along with hair, color palettes, and accessory placement. Fantasy-only elements such as wings, horns, and tails are available, and the final render can be framed with selectable backgrounds and camera-angle tweaks.

What devices and permissions it requires
The app runs on Android and notes compatibility beginning around Android 5.0, so it targets a broad set of phones and tablets. Creating a photo-derived avatar requires camera or gallery access to import a template image, and the app stores completed avatars in an integrated gallery. Those device-level permissions are central to the core workflow and to saving or exporting finished images.
How approachable it is for everyday creators
The interface is designed for quick navigation, which suits people who want a ready avatar without a long learning curve. Controls group visual layers and styling choices so casual users can assemble a profile image in a few steps. The asset library and hair color options support fast iteration for social media pictures, while the gallery helps manage multiple versions without leaving the app.
Privacy notes, developer background, and its place among rivals
The app accepts user photos as inputs, so expect image permissions during setup and local gallery storage of creations. The developer, tokulen, focuses on multimedia and personalization apps, which aligns with the app's editor and gallery features. Inclusion of fantasy-themed assets is a distinguishing element compared with standard avatar makers, a point users cite when choosing this specific tool.
